In this episode we speak with Sydney native Tim Fung, Founder and CEO of AirTasker - the online community for with over 1.5 million users!

 

Airtasker was borne out of a very real frustration Tim had when moving house. He needed assistance with smaller jobs but no marketplace existed - so he did what any natural entrepreneur should do and built one!

 

Tim has gained a mass of experience over the years, including working in Finance, being involved with other startups, and even “looking after Victoria’s Secret’s models”!

 

Tim and Airtasker have raised a huge $32million in funding and are now expanding into the UK after great success in Australia.

 

In the ever expanding market of the “gig economy” apps like AirTasker play an important role in allowing people to outsource small tasks, and allow people to find quick jobs.
